Sizing and Servings

When it comes to serving sizes, a 6-inch cake can serve 6-8 people, depending on the size of the slices. This makes it perfect for small gatherings, such as birthday parties, anniversaries, or dinner parties. However, if you’re planning a larger celebration, you may need to consider a larger cake or multiple 6-inch cakes. To determine the serving size, consider the height and density of the cake, as well as the serving style – will you be serving slices, wedges, or bites?

To give you a better idea, let’s consider a few scenarios. If you’re serving a dense, moist cake, you may be able to get 6-8 servings from a 6-inch cake. However, if you’re serving a lighter, fluffier cake, you may only get 4-6 servings. It’s also important to consider the serving style – if you’re serving slices, you may be able to get more servings than if you’re serving wedges or bites.

Baking a 6-Inch Cake

Baking a 6-inch cake requires attention to temperature, timing, and ingredient ratios. Since the cake is small, it can be prone to overcooking or undercooking, so it’s essential to keep a close eye on the temperature and baking time. You can use a variety of recipes and techniques, such as the ‘water bath’ method or the ‘cake strip’ method, to ensure that the cake is baked evenly and consistently.

One of the most important things to keep in mind when baking a 6-inch cake is the ingredient ratio. A recipe that’s designed for a larger cake may not work well for a 6-inch cake, so it’s essential to adjust the ingredient ratios accordingly. For example, a recipe that calls for 2 cups of flour for a 9-inch cake may only require 1 cup of flour for a 6-inch cake. By understanding the importance of ingredient ratios and adjusting your recipe accordingly, you can create a delicious and moist 6-inch cake that’s sure to impress.

How do I prevent my 6-inch cake from becoming too dense or dry?

To prevent your 6-inch cake from becoming too dense or dry, it’s essential to follow a few key tips. First, make sure to use the right ratio of ingredients, including flour, sugar, and liquid. A cake that’s too dense or dry can be the result of too much flour or not enough liquid.

Second, make sure to not overmix the batter. Overmixing can cause the cake to become tough and dense, while undermixing can cause it to be too wet and soggy. By mixing the batter just until the ingredients are combined, you can create a cake that’s light and fluffy. Finally, make sure to not overbake the cake. A cake that’s overbaked can be dry and crumbly, while a cake that’s underbaked can be too wet and soggy. By following these tips, you can create a delicious and moist 6-inch cake that’s sure to impress.

Can I use a 6-inch cake as a base for a cake pop or cake ball?

Yes, you can use a 6-inch cake as a base for a cake pop or cake ball. In fact, a 6-inch cake can be a great option for making cake pops or cake balls, since it’s small and easy to work with. To make a cake pop or cake ball, you’ll need to crumble the cake into fine crumbs and mix it with a small amount of frosting or binding agent.

You can then shape the mixture into balls or other shapes, and dip them in chocolate or other coatings to create a delicious and unique treat. How do I transport a 6-inch cake without damaging it?

To transport a 6-inch cake without damaging it, it’s essential to take a few key precautions. First, make sure to wrap the cake tightly in plastic wrap or aluminum foil to prevent it from getting damaged or dislodged during transport.

Second, place the cake in a sturdy container or cake box to protect it from bumps and shocks. You can also use a non-slip mat or cake pad to prevent the cake from sliding or moving around during transport. Finally, make sure to keep the cake level and stable during transport, and avoid exposing it to extreme temperatures or humidity. By taking these precautions, you can transport your 6-inch cake safely and securely, and ensure that it arrives at its destination in perfect condition.
